This book provides the reader with a complete coverage of radio
resource management for 3G wireless communications
Systems Engineering in Wireless Communications focuses on
the area of radio resource management in third generation wireless
communication systems from a systems engineering perspective. The
authors provide an introduction into cellular radio systems as well
as a review of radio resource management issues. Additionally, a
detailed discussion of power control, handover, admission control,
smart antennas, joint optimization of different radio resources ,
and cognitive radio networksis offered. This book differs from
books currently available, with its emphasis on the dynamical
issues arising from mobile nodes in the network. Well-known control
techniques, such as least squares estimation, PID control, Kalman
filers, adaptive control, and fuzzy logic are used throughout the
book.
Key Features:
* Covers radio resource management of third generation wireless
communication systems at a systems level
* First book to address wireless communications issues using
systems engineering methods
* Offers the latest research activity in the field of wireless
communications, extending to the control engineering
community
* Includes an accompanying website containing
MATLAB(TM)/SIMULINK(TM) exercises
* Provides illustrations of wireless networks
This book will be a valuable reference for graduate and
postgraduate students studying wireless communications and control
engineering courses, and R&D engineers.
